    set clear goals before you attend

    Every physician or healthcare worker goes to conferences with different priorities. Some want to explore new clinical research. Others are eager to improve their procedural skills or build connections for collaborative projects. Write down three precise goals before you leave. Examples include:

    • Learning the latest updates on sepsis protocols.
    • Finding new devices or software to speed triage processes.
    • Meeting potential mentors or colleagues working in disaster response.

    Clarity prevents aimless wandering and helps you select which sessions to prioritize.

    plan your schedule but stay flexible

    FISEM conferences usually offer simultaneous sessions, workshops, and poster presentations. Trying to attend every event is impossible. Identify your must-see speakers and workshops based on your goals. Download the program in advance and mark these sessions on a calendar. If unexpected opportunities arise—like a chance to discuss a case with a keynote speaker—be ready to adjust your plan. Balance structured scheduling with some room for spontaneous learning.

    prepare questions and materials

    Approach sessions actively by preparing questions related to topics you want to clarify or challenge. For example, if a speaker discusses new airway management techniques, ask about indications, contraindications, and training requirements. Also, bring business cards or contact information to share with new connections. Many conferences offer mobile apps for scheduling and messaging other attendees—use these tools to streamline communication.

    participate in workshops for hands-on practice

    Theoretical knowledge is valuable, but hands-on workshops often solidify skills more effectively. FISEM events include procedural trainings on intubation, ultrasound, or advanced cardiac life support. These sessions allow you to get practical experience under expert supervision. If you work in a resource-limited environment, ask instructors about techniques adaptable to your setting. Hands-on opportunities help retain skills long after the conference ends.

    take notes and review them promptly

    During sessions, jot down key points, interesting statistics, or insights. Use shorthand or voice memos if that works better for you. After each day, spend 15 to 30 minutes reviewing notes and highlighting actionable steps. This reflection process helps transfer knowledge from short-term memory to long-term habits. Consider organizing digital notes by theme (e.g., triage, trauma, pharmacology) for future reference.

    build meaningfully professional relationships

    Networking at emergency medicine conferences can open unexpected doors. Rather than collecting business cards, focus on meaningful conversations. Share your experiences and challenges honestly, and listen to others. Exchanging ideas about overcoming common obstacles enriches everyone’s practice. Follow up with contacts after the event to maintain dialogue. Building a community of colleagues reduces professional isolation and creates avenues for collaborative research or quality improvement projects.

    apply what you learn and track results

    Once back at work, pick two or three changes from your conference experience to implement. For example, you might integrate a new triage scoring system or advocate for a training program based on a successful workshop. Document how these changes affect patient care metrics like wait times, complication rates, or staff confidence. Tracking outcomes validates the time and effort spent attending the conference and identifies areas needing further improvement.

    Assessing Your Home’s Vulnerabilities

    Every region has its own set of natural threats. Living in a coastal area means preparing for hurricanes and storm surges. If you’re in a wildfire-prone zone, your concerns will center on ember resistance and defensible space. Earthquakes require seismic retrofitting. Understanding your local climate, geology, and typical weather patterns is the first critical step. Don’t guess; research your area’s specific risks. Local government websites and emergency management agencies often provide detailed hazard maps and information.

    Strengthening the Structure

    Physical modifications to your home can make a substantial difference. For wind-prone areas, this could mean reinforcing your roof, windows, and doors. Impact-resistant windows and storm shutters are effective barriers against high winds and flying debris. In earthquake zones, bracing your foundation and securing any tall furniture that could tip over are essential. Even small changes, like ensuring proper anchoring of your water heater, can prevent secondary damage.

    Creating Defensible Space

    For those in wildfire-prone regions, creating defensible space around your home is paramount. This involves managing vegetation to reduce fuel loads. Clear dry leaves and pine needles from your roof and gutters regularly. Trim tree branches that hang over your house. Maintain a buffer zone of low-flammable vegetation or non-combustible landscaping like gravel or rock within a specified distance from your home. This makes your property less susceptible to ignition and gives firefighters a safer area to work from.

    Developing an Emergency Plan

    Beyond physical improvements, a comprehensive emergency plan is vital. This plan should cover multiple scenarios and include communication strategies for family members. Everyone in the household needs to know what to do, where to meet if separated, and how to shut off utilities if necessary. Designate an out-of-state contact person whom all family members can check in with if local communication lines are down. Practice your plan regularly, especially with children, so it becomes second nature.

    Assembling a Disaster Kit

    A well-stocked disaster kit is your lifeline when immediate help isn’t available. Aim for at least a 72-hour supply of essentials. Your kit should include:

    • Non-perishable food and water (one gallon per person per day)
    • A first-aid kit with necessary medications
    • Flashlights with extra batteries
    • A multi-tool or wrench to turn off utilities
    • A NOAA weather radio or hand-crank radio
    • Sanitation and personal hygiene items
    • Copies of important documents in a waterproof bag
    • Cash in small denominations

    Regular Review and Maintenance

    Preparedness isn’t a one-time task. Your home changes, your family grows, and the environment evolves. Make it a habit to review and update your disaster plan and kit at least annually. Check expiration dates on food, water, and medications. Test your smoke detectors and carbon monoxide alarms. Ensure your emergency contact information is current. By staying vigilant and regularly tending to your preparedness efforts, you significantly enhance your home’s and family’s ability to withstand and recover from disruptive events.

    Why local observations matter more than ever

    Over the last decade, scientists have struggled to track migratory patterns and population shifts caused by habitat loss and climate change. Satellite imagery and automated sensors provide important snapshots but often lack the consistent, on-the-ground observations necessary to understand animal behavior contextually. Local community reports deliver unique insights into microhabitat changes, unusual sightings, and emerging threats.

    Studies show that such citizen-generated data can pinpoint trends with impressive accuracy. In a project comparing citizen reports to traditional surveys of bird populations, volunteers flagged new nesting grounds up to two months before official recognition. This early warning system allows conservationists to act sooner, sometimes preventing irreversible damage.

    Technology simplifying participation in wildlife monitoring

    The rise of smartphones equipped with GPS and decent cameras means nearly anyone can act as a naturalist. However, technology alone doesn’t guarantee good data. Platforms must balance ease of use with quality control to make submissions credible and useful for researchers.

    Phanpy addresses this by integrating simple prompts to guide users in collecting relevant information like location, time, weather conditions, and species details. It also includes tutorials on ethical wildlife observation to minimize human impact. This approach increases data reliability, encouraging scientists to incorporate these community records into their larger models. The result is a richer, more dynamic dataset than either side working in isolation could achieve.
